Tiree vs Florianopolis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Tiree, Uk and Florianopolis, Brazil is approximately 10,140 km or 6,301 mi.
  • To reach Tiree in this distance one would set out from Florianopolis bearing 21.5°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Tiree bearing 36.1° or NE .
  • Tiree has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Florianopolis has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• The mean annual temperature is 11.5 °C (20.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.2 °C (0.4°F) more in Tiree.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 372.1 mm (14.6 in) less which is equivalent to 372.1 l/m² (9.13 US gal/ft²) or 3,721,000 l/ha (397,800 US gal/ac) less. About 3/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 28.1° lower in Tiree than in Florianopolis.
